What is Performance Analytics?

Performance Analytics refers to the process of collecting, analyzing, and interpreting data to evaluate the efficiency and effectiveness of an organization, team, or individual. Professionals in this field use metrics and key performance indicators (KPIs) to monitor progress, identify trends, and support data-driven decision-making. Performance Analytics is commonly used in business, sports, IT, and other sectors to optimize processes and achieve strategic goals.

How much does a performance analyst get paid?

Performance analysts typically earn a median annual salary of around $65,000 to $85,000, depending on experience, industry, and location. Entry-level roles may start lower, while experienced analysts with specialized skills or certifications can earn higher salaries. Many performance analysts also work with data analysis tools like Excel, SQL, or Tableau.

How does a Performance Analytics professional typically collaborate with other departments within an organization?

Performance Analytics professionals regularly partner with teams such as operations, finance, and marketing to gather relevant data and translate it into actionable insights. They often participate in cross-functional meetings to understand business goals and tailor their analyses accordingly. Clear communication is crucial, as they must explain complex metrics to non-technical stakeholders and help implement data-driven strategies. This collaborative environment fosters a strong understanding of the broader business and can open doors to advancement in various domains.

What does a performance analyst do?

A performance analyst evaluates and monitors an organization’s operational and financial performance using data analysis tools and techniques. They identify trends, generate reports, and provide insights to support decision-making and improve efficiency. Strong analytical skills and proficiency with software like Excel or specialized analytics platforms are essential for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Performance Analytics professional, and why are they important?

To thrive in Performance Analytics, you need strong analytical skills, proficiency in data interpretation, and typically a degree in statistics, mathematics, business, or a related field. Familiarity with data visualization tools (such as Tableau or Power BI), statistical analysis software (like R or Python), and experience with databases are often required. Exceptional probl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help professionals translate complex data into actionable insights. These skills are crucial for driving data-informed decisions and optimizing organizational performance.
